About

Bruce D. Huibregtse is a personal injury attorney with over 47 years of legal experience, practicing at Law Offices of Bruce D. Huibregtse in Madison, WI. He earned a degree from University of Wisconsin, Madison B.B.A. in 1976 and a J.D. from University of Wisconsin Law School in 1979. He has been admitted to the Wisconsin Bar since 1979. His practice encompasses personal injury, litigation, and insurance, allowing him to serve clients across a range of legal needs. He ma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
